TEAM CoBra promoted in SAL !

On Saturday 8th August, Team CoBra – the combined team drawing on senior athletes from Braintree & District AC and Colchester Harriers – won the final Southern Athletics League fixture of the 2026 season and gained promotion from Division 3 East to Division 2.

Congratulations to all athletes, team managers and volunteers who have represented and helped the team during the year.

The team finished the competition with 358.5 points, ahead of Thurrock with 318, and Basildon 311.5, all some way ahead of the other four teams.

Top performers from Braintree & District AC include:

  • August Moldova, our Masters over-40 sprinter who scored 2 B-string victories , a 4.42m life-time best in Long Jump (2nd A-string)), an A-string win in the High Jump with 1.38m. She was also a member of the winning 4x100m relay, racking up 34 points.
  • Kelly Ayitefio with a win tin the 400m and 3rd in 3rd in the 100m, 4x100m relay and 4x400m relay scored 22 points.
  • Fraya Davey 2nd B-string Shot and 3rd B-string Discus scored 11 points.

Braintree & District AC enjoy home success

Braintree & District AC hosted a Southern Athletics League Round 2 match on Sunday 21st June for ‘Senior Age Group’ athletes. And, in partnership with Colchester Harriers, we won! The joint team (Team COBRA) scored a very creditable 402 match points ahead of 2nd place Basildon with 348.5 points, and Thurrock with 318 points.

After 2 matches (with 2 matches to go), that puts Team COBRA on on 12.5 league points, Thurrock on 12 points and Basildon on 11.5 points.

Other teams in the division are West Norfolk, City of Southend, Ryston, and West Suffolk.
